Monthly budget at $75K โ Washington vs Kigali
| Expense | Washington | Kigali |
|---|---|---|
| Monthly take-home | $4,378 | $4,741 |
| 1BR rent | $3,100 | $500 |
| Groceries | $422 | $380 |
| Transport | $100 | $150 |
| Utilities | $190 | $60 |
| Internet | $75 | $35 |
| Left after essentials | $491 | $3,616 |
